CVE-2020-7874

CVE-2020-7874 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 8.8/10 on the CVSS scale. Download of code without integrity check vulnerability in NEXACRO14 Runtime ActiveX control of tobesoft Co., Ltd allows the attacker to cause an arbitrary file download and execution. This vulnerability is due to incomplete validation of file download URL or file extension.. EPSS estimates a 0.56%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
